Margot Robbie Says She And Ryan Gosling Were "Mortified" When Leaked Photos From Barbie Set Went Viral

Margot Robbie said the public reaction to the leaked photos of her in Barbie's costume was "the most humiliating moment" of her life.

 

 

Currently in production and due to be released in 2023, Margot Robbie will play the eponymous fashion doll Barbie in the live-action drama. Ryan Gosling will feature as Barbie's love interest Ken while America Ferrera, Simu Liu and Will Ferrell are also set to feature in the movie.

Margot Robbie was "mortified" when photos leaked from the set of Barbie went viral.

Speaking to Jimmy Fallon on The Tonight Show, Robbie said: “I can’t tell you how mortified we were, by the way.


“We look like we’re like laughing and having fun, but we’re dying on the inside. Dying. I was like, this is the most humiliating moment of my life.”


Asked if the two-time Oscar nominee expected the pictures to dominate the internet in the way that they did, she added: “No! I mean, I knew that we had some exteriors to shoot in LA. I knew once you were doing exteriors, you’re gonna get papped.


"There’s probably going to be a little crowd of people who are going to take notice because, you know, we stand out a little bit in those outfits. So I knew there was going to be a little bit of attention, and probably some photos would get out there, but not like it did.


"It was like mad. It was like hundreds of people watching all time.”

Despite the set pictures leak, plot details of Barbie remain a mystery. Robbie — whose latest movie, the David O'Russell-helmed Amsterdam, opens next month — did warn people that the movie might not be what they are expecting.


In a Vogue interview last year,  she said: "It comes with a lot of baggage! And a lot of nostalgic connections. But with that come a lot of exciting ways to attack it. People generally hear Barbie and think, ‘I know what that movie is going to be,’ and then they hear that Greta Gerwig is writing and directing it, and they’re like, ‘Oh, well, maybe I don’t'."
